Steve Taylor Jr.

Simeon High School

First team all-state selection by Associated Press and the Chicago Tribune … Helped lead Chicago's Simeon High School to three-straight state championships … Team compiled an overall record of 63-3 in his two years as a full-time starter … Grabbed 15 rebounds in the state title game as a senior … Averaged 16.0 points, 9.0 rebounds, 3.0 blocks and 3.0 assists per game in 2011-12 … McDonald's All-America High School Basketball honoree … Nationally recognized recruit under head coach Robert Smith … Ranked 73rd overall by Scout.com and 109th by Rivals.com … Ranked 15th and 24th, respectively, at his position by each of those outlets … ESPN.com placed him 22nd amongst all small forwards in the nation and 83rd in the ESPNU 100 … Taylor averaged 9.5 points and 7.0 rebounds per game as a junior, helping the program to a 30-2 overall record … Netted 20 points and grabbed 11 rebounds in the Wolverines' supersectional victory over Farragut … Was named All-State Special Mention by the Chicago Tribune as a junior

Personal

Son of Steve Taylor Sr. and Diana Cooper … Has four brothers (Demetrius Cooper, Marquell Rose, Rashad Lockhart and Javonte Taylor) and one sister (Diana Taylor) … Majoring in broadcast and electronic communication.
